WebBinary logistic regression: In this approach, the response or dependent variable is dichotomous in nature—i.e. it has only two possible outcomes (e.g. 0 or 1). Some popular examples of its use include predicting if an e-mail is spam or not spam or if a tumor is malignant or not malignant. Web22 mei 2024 · Logistic regression is used to calculate the probability of a binary event occurring, and to deal with issues of classification. For example, predicting if an incoming email is spam or not spam, or predicting if a credit card transaction is fraudulent or not fraudulent.
